Gusto

ahd-5
  • noun. Vigorous enjoyment; zest: synonym: zest.
  • noun. undefined
  • noun. Individual taste.
  • noun. Artistic style.
  • The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
  • noun. Appreciative taste or enjoyment; keen relish; zest.
  • noun. Artistic ‘style’ or ‘taste’: as, the grand gusto (It. il gran gusto), the grand style.
  • the GNU version of the Collaborative International Dictionary of English
  • noun. Nice or keen appreciation or enjoyment; relish; taste; fancy.
  • Wiktionary,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License
  • noun. enthusiasm; enjoyment, vigor
  • WordNet 3.0 Copyright 2006 by Princeton University. All rights reserved.
  • noun. vigorous and enthusiastic enjoyment
